To convert Square Mile to Square Kilometer: multiply by 2.58999. 1 mi² × 2.58999 = 2.58999 km²
| Square Mile (mi²) | Square Kilometer (km²) |
|---|---|
| 0.1 mi² | 0.258999 km² |
| 0.25 mi² | 0.647497 km² |
| 0.5 mi² | 1.29499 km² |
| 1 mi² | 2.58999 km² |
| 2 mi² | 5.17998 km² |
| 5 mi² | 12.9499 km² |
| 10 mi² | 25.8999 km² |
| 20 mi² | 51.7998 km² |
| 25 mi² | 64.7497 km² |
| 50 mi² | 129.499 km² |
| 100 mi² | 258.999 km² |
| 250 mi² | 647.497 km² |
| 500 mi² | 1294.99 km² |
| 1,000 mi² | 2589.99 km² |

There are 2.59 square kilometer in 1 square mile.
Multiply your square mile value by 2.59. For quick mental math, you can round to 2.6 when precision is not critical.
Square Mile is larger than Square Kilometer: 1 Square Mile equals 2.59 Square Kilometer.
Square Mile is primarily used in the United States and some Commonwealth nations.Square Kilometer is primarily used in most countries globally.
